It will be cold, with snow & ice possible - dress appropriately. Gremlin Graveyard also has lots of stumps & potentially mud depending on the season. The run in the dry is stock friendly with several harder obstacles & hill climbs for the modified rigs. Conditions change with the weather & although we will do our best to keep you & your rig from damage, it is possible. Skids & sliders are recommended but not necessary. Make sure your rig has at least one frame mounted recovery point. Airing down will be mandatory for this run (recommend running max at 20psi). There's a gas station near by to air up. Your fellow wheelers may offer you their air-up equipment at their discretion, but do not expect it.
